Log Pricing Matrix Changes

Oracle CPQ 26B enhances administrative logging for pricing matrices by capturing before-and-after values of changes, in addition to existing audit data (who and when changes were made).

Administrators can select the Enable Pricing History option for an Attribute-based Charge template to specify which template columns will log pricing history.

Enable Pricing History Options

View Change History

When change history is enabled for an Attribute-based Charge template column, users can view change history for an individual pricing matrix row item in a product charge.

  1. Navigate to a product charge with dynamic attribute-based pricing.
  2. Select View Change History from the line ellipsis menu for a pricing matrix row item.

View Change History

The change history displays the logged changes, who made the changes, and when the changes were made.

Change History

Export Change History

When change history is enabled for an Attribute-based Charge template column, users can also export all change history for product model with attribute-based matrix pricing.

  1. Navigate to CPQ Admin > Prices > Price Models.
  2. Select the applicable price model.
  3. Select Export > Export Change History from the Pricing Data Actions menu.

Export Change History

  1. If applicable, enable Filter by change time, and enter a Start Date and End Date.
  2. When the export is complete, click on the Export Finished link.

Export Change History interface

  1. Open and unzip the downloaded change history file to view the pricing history.

Histroy Excell file

Before-and-after audit logging captures detailed change history for pricing matrices, including prior and new values, user identity, and change timestamps to support audit readiness to provide the following business benefits:

  • SOX-Ready Financial Controls: Delivers robust, traceable audit trails for list prices and pricing adjustments, supporting compliance, and improving trust in financial reporting for revenue-impacting changes.

  • Simplifies Audits & Reduces Risk: Removes the need for manual evidence gathering (such as Excel versions or screenshots), streamlines audit processes, and minimizes the risk of pricing manipulation or unauthorized adjustments.

Steps to enable and configure

Enable Price History for a Pricing Matrix Template Column

Complete the following steps to enable price history for an Attribute-based Charge type Pricing Matrix Template column.

  1. Navigate to CPQ Admin > Prices > Pricing Matrix Templates.
  2. Click on the applicable Attribute-based Charge type template.
  3. Click on the applicable template column, then click Edit.
  4. Check the Enable Pricing History option.
  5. Click Save or Update.

Display Enable Price History Pricing Matrix Template Column

Complete the following steps to enable price history for an Attribute-based Charge type Pricing Matrix Template column.

  1. Navigate to CPQ Admin > Prices > Pricing Matrix Templates.
  2. Click on the applicable Attribute-based Charge type template.
  3. Select Manage Columns from the Actions menu.
  4. Check the Enable Price History column.
  5. Click Apply.